Maison développement back-end tutoriel php 提取字符串中数字解决办法

提取字符串中数字解决办法

Jun 13, 2016 am 10:04 AM
intval match Note quot

提取字符串中数字
现在有
$z="note1"
怎么用正则取出其中的1
让$z="1"
此时$z是str
怎么把它变成数字类型呢

------解决方案--------------------
$z="note1";
preg_match('/([0-9]+)/', $z,$marray);
$z=$marray[1];
$z=intval($z);//多余的,php是弱类型

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n

Outils d'IA chauds

Undresser.AI Undress

Undresser.AI Undress

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over

AI Clothes Remover

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ool

Undress AI Tool

Images de déshabillage gratuites

Clothoff.io

Clothoff.io

Dissolvant de vêtements AI

AI Hentai Generator

AI Hentai Generator

Générez AI Hentai gratuitement.

Article chaud

R.E.P.O. Crystals d'énergie expliqués et ce qu'ils font (cristal jaune)
3 Il y a quelques semaines By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Meilleurs paramètres graphiques
3 Il y a quelques semaines By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Comment réparer l'audio si vous n'entendez personne
3 Il y a quelques semaines By 尊渡假赌尊渡假赌尊渡假赌
WWE 2K25: Comment déverrouiller tout dans Myrise
4 Il y a quelques semaines By 尊渡假赌尊渡假赌尊渡假赌

Outils chauds

Bloc-notes++7.3.1

Bloc-notes++7.3.1

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ise

SublimeText3 version chinoise

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1

Envoyer Studio 13.0.1

Puissant environnement de développement intégré PHP

Dreamweaver CS6

Dreamweaver CS6

Outils de développement Web visuel

SublimeText3 version Mac

SublimeText3 version Mac

Logiciel d'édition de code au niveau de Dieu (SublimeText3)

php提交表单通过后,弹出的对话框怎样在当前页弹出,该如何解决 php提交表单通过后,弹出的对话框怎样在当前页弹出,该如何解决 Jun 13, 2016 am 10:23 AM

php提交表单通过后,弹出的对话框怎样在当前页弹出php提交表单通过后,弹出的对话框怎样在当前页弹出而不是在空白页弹出?想实现这样的效果:而不是空白页弹出:------解决方案--------------------如果你的验证用PHP在后端,那么就用Ajax;仅供参考:HTML code

Infinix Note 40s est répertorié en ligne avec toutes les fonctionnalités et spécifications Infinix Note 40s est répertorié en ligne avec toutes les fonctionnalités et spécifications Jun 30, 2024 pm 09:32 PM

Infinix Note 40s est le dernier ajout à la gamme Note 40. Il n’y a pas grand-chose de secret ; le téléphone est désormais répertorié avec toutes ses fonctionnalités sur la page Web officielle, comme l'a repéré PassionateGeekz. Autres téléphones actuellement trouvés dans la série Infinix Note (le

Compétences pratiques PHP : maîtriser l'utilisation correcte de la fonction intval Compétences pratiques PHP : maîtriser l'utilisation correcte de la fonction intval Mar 09, 2024 pm 09:27 PM

La fonction intval en PHP est une fonction utilisée pour convertir une variable en type entier. Son utilisation est relativement simple, mais certaines compétences et précautions doivent être maîtrisées. Une utilisation correcte de la fonction intval peut gérer efficacement les problèmes de conversion de type de données et éviter les erreurs dans le programme. L'utilisation de base de la fonction intval La syntaxe de base de la fonction intval est la suivante : intval($var,$base=10) où $var représente la variable à convertir en entier,

Méthode de correspondance en Java Méthode de correspondance en Java Apr 28, 2023 pm 10:31 PM

Notez que match est utilisé pour les opérations de correspondance et que sa valeur de retour est de type booléen. Grâce à la correspondance, vous pouvez simplement vérifier si un certain élément existe dans la liste. Exemple // Vérifiez s'il y a une chaîne dans la liste commençant par a et correspond à la première, c'est-à-dire return truebooleananyStartsWithA=stringCollection.stream().anyMatch((s)->s.startsWith("a")) ;System.out .println(anyStartsWithA);//true//Vérifiez si la chaîne dans la liste

Comment utiliser des expressions régulières pour faire correspondre des chaînes en Java ? Comment utiliser des expressions régulières pour faire correspondre des chaînes en Java ? Apr 19, 2023 pm 02:37 PM

Concept 1. Diverses opérations de correspondance peuvent être utilisées pour déterminer si un prédicat donné répond aux éléments d'un flux. 2. L'opération de correspondance est une opération de terminal et renvoie une valeur booléenne. Instance booleananyStartsWithA=stringCollection.stream().anyMatch((s)->s.startsWith("a"));System.out.println(anyStartsWithA);//truebooleanallStartsWithA=stringCollection.stream().

Comment utiliser Java Match Comment utiliser Java Match Apr 18, 2023 pm 01:55 PM

Concept 1. Diverses opérations de correspondance peuvent être utilisées pour déterminer si un prédicat donné répond aux éléments d'un flux. 2. L'opération de correspondance est une opération de terminal et renvoie une valeur booléenne. Instance booleananyStartsWithA=stringCollection.stream().anyMatch((s)->s.startsWith("a"));System.out.println(anyStartsWithA);//truebooleanallStartsWithA=stringCollection.stream().

不用数据库来实现用户的简单的下载,代码如下,但是却不能下载,请高手找下原因,文件路劲什么的没有关问题 不用数据库来实现用户的简单的下载,代码如下,但是却不能下载,请高手找下原因,文件路劲什么的没有关问题 Jun 13, 2016 am 10:15 AM

不用数据库来实现用户的简单的下载,代码如下,但是却不能下载,请高手找下原因,文件路劲什么的没问题。

Le nouveau téléphone de milieu de gamme est équipé d'un écran hyperbolique 1,5K + objectif de semelle extérieure 50Mp et peut appartenir à la série Xiaomi Redmi Note Le nouveau téléphone de milieu de gamme est équipé d'un écran hyperbolique 1,5K + objectif de semelle extérieure 50Mp et peut appartenir à la série Xiaomi Redmi Note Jul 30, 2024 pm 12:45 PM

Le 29 juillet, le célèbre blogueur numérique @digitalchat.com a révélé les informations de configuration clés de la prochaine série de téléphones de milieu de gamme d'une certaine marque. La section des commentaires et les informations divulguées suggéraient qu'il s'agirait du téléphone de la série Redmi Note14 de Xiaomi. 1. Selon les blogueurs, cette série de téléphones de milieu de gamme adoptera un écran hyperboloïde de résolution 1,5K et sera équipée d'un module d'objectif elliptique à semelle extérieure de 50 mégapixels (50 Mp). En termes de matériau du corps, cette série de téléphones mobiles semble avoir choisi un cadre central en plastique plus économique et est également équipée d'une technologie de déverrouillage optique par empreinte digitale à courte portée. En termes de processeur, la version ultra-large de cette série de téléphones mobiles devrait être équipée du processeur de la série Dimensity de MediaTek, fabriqué selon le processus TSMC 4 nm de deuxième génération, avec une fréquence principale allant jusqu'à 3,0 GHz. Ces informations de configuration

See all articles